What is NMIMS LAT 2026 Question Paper Pattern?
The NMIMS LAT 2026 Question Paper will carry 150 questions. The exam will be held in an online computer-based mode. The NMIMS LAT Question Paper will have five sections (30 questions each) covering Verbal Reasoning, General Knowledge, Quantitative Reasoning, Logical Reasoning, & Legal Reasoning. There is no negative marking. The exam will have only multiple-choice questions (MCQs). To be fully prepared for the exam, candidates must refer to the NMIMS LAT Exam Pattern 2026.

The NMIMS LAT is a university-level entrance exam for undergraduate 5-year integrated law programs (B.A. LL.B/B.B.A. LL.B) at SVKM's Narsee Monjee Institute of Management Studies. It is a 120-minute, online computer-based test with 150 MCQs targeting high-school (10+2) level proficiency.
The NMIMS LAT syllabus 2026 consists of five core sections: Verbal Reasoning, General Knowledge & Current Affairs, Quantitative Reasoning, Logical Reasoning, and Legal Reasoning. The 120-minute exam features 150 total questions with no negative marking. It covers topics like comprehension, grammar, basic math, static GK, and legal principles.

Candidates must note that there is no negative marking in the NMIMS LAT exam. Candidates get 1 mark for each correct answer.
The NMIMS LAT exam is for 150 marks. A total of 150 questions are asked, each for 1 mark.
